MagicLeap 1, the AR headset that helped the Plantation, Florida-based startup attract over three billion dollars in funding, will be completely defunct by late next year. The company announced this week that MagicLeap 1’s cloud services are due to be shut off on December 31st, 2024.
Generally, “the cloud” refers to remote servers that do work off of a device. For example, MagicLeap has had a partnership with Google Cloud for the past year now. MagicLeap’s transition to an enterprise company is now complete after this week the company has killed the last sign of its creative-oriented past.

Digilens shows a reference design for AR glasses. DigiLens, one of the most important Waveguide optics manufacturers, has just announced the “Design v1”, a reference design for modular AR glasses.
